| 2.CHECK WIRE HARNESS (DOUBLE DOOR LOCK ECU - BATTERY AND BODY GROUND) |
![]() |
Disconnect the D2 ECU connector.
Measure the voltage of the wire harness side connector.
| Tester Connection | Specified Condition |
| D2-1 (+B) - Body ground | 10 to 14 V |
Measure the resistance of the wire harness side connector.
| Tester Connection | Specified Condition |
| D2-14 (GND) - Body ground | Below 1 Ω |

| 3.CHECK RESISTANCE OF COMMUNICATION LINE |
Disconnect the P19 and G1 ECU connectors (w/o Driving position memory).
Disconnect the P19 and T4 ECU connectors (w/ Driving position memory).

Measure the resistance of the wire harness side connectors.
| Tester Connection | Specified Condition |
| D2-9 (MPX1) - P19-7 (MPX1) | Below 1 Ω |
| D2-9 (MPX1) - G1-12 (MPD2) (*2) | Below 1 Ω |
| D2-9 (MPX1) - T4-5 (MPX1) (*1) | Below 1 Ω |
